Definition of Desideratum

a wished-for or desired thing

Examples of Desideratum in a sentence

A desideratum when car shopping is price.  ๐Ÿ”Š

A desideratum for the role of teacher was certification in English.  ๐Ÿ”Š

Because a desideratum when house shopping was location, the couple only viewed houses in the city limits.  ๐Ÿ”Š

Since the desideratum was non-negotiable, the man would not allow smoking in the building.  ๐Ÿ”Š

The desideratum for the job was someone with flexibility and experience in the field.  ๐Ÿ”Š
